gpt4 book ai didi

jquery-mobile - JQM 1.4.1 : The new event 'pagecontainershow'

转载 作者:行者123 更新时间:2023-12-02 01:52:46 25 4
gpt4 key购买 nike

我对 JQM 的变化感到困惑:

您可能知道 JQM 弃用了该事件:

$(document).on('pageshow', '#MyPage', function(){ 

并将其替换为:

$(document).on('pagecontainershow', function (e, ui) {

但是,这个新事件并不像以前那样附加到特定页面。然而,事件:

$(document).on('pagecreate', '#MyPage', function(){ 

仍然附加到特定页面,我认为其他页面事件仍然附加到特定页面。

我的问题是:

有些事件附加到页面而其他事件没有,这一事实使框架非常困惑。标准化所有事件不是更好吗,因为版本 1.3 中所有事件都附加到页面?

将来“pagecreate”事件和所有页面事件是否会分离到页面,因为“pageshow”现在是 1.4.1 版本

谁能解释一下事件在 1.4.1 中是如何工作的

谢谢

最佳答案

我刚刚通过使用像这样的“切换大小写”语句解决了 pagecontainershow 无法附加到 PAGE 的问题:

$(document).on('pagecontainershow', function (e, ui) {

var ThisPage = $(':mobile-pagecontainer').pagecontainer('getActivePage').attr('id');

switch(ThisPage){

case 'Page1':

case 'Page2':

case 'Page3':


etc....

但是我担心的是,如果他们修改框架以支持(再次返回)附加到页面的事件,那么我应该进行返工和返工。

关于jquery-mobile - JQM 1.4.1 : The new event 'pagecontainershow' 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21801315/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com